According to the records here, Cao Cao marched into Hanzhong in March, and returned to Chang 'an in "Summer May". In August and September, Guan Yu was broken when he went south from Luoyang to save Coss to Mobei, so he returned to Luoyang in winter and October, and never returned to Hanzhong again. Since Yang Xiu died in the autumn of twenty-four years, and Cao Cao died more than a hundred days after his death, according to Cao Cao, he died on Gengzi Day in the first month of twenty-five years. Therefore, Yang Xiu should have died in September of twenty-four years during Cao Cao's rescue of Coss, no more than "winter October". Therefore, Yang Xiu died in Hanzhong because of the "chicken ribs". The crime of Yang Xiu's death is unknown now, but the cause of his death is complicated, and the main reason is two major political factors.
first, Yang Xiu committed a taboo in the ancient royal power struggle and participated in the struggle for office.
Second, Yang Biao and Yang Xiu's own identities and political ideas conflict with the interests of Cao Wei's regime. Mrs. Yang Biao is Yuan Shu's sister, and Yang Xiu is Yuan Shu's nephew. However, Yang Biao and Yang Xiu's political ideas are the same as those of Kong Rong and Mi Heng, so they are jealous.
when Yang Xiu was first appointed as the prime minister's master book, it should be said that he was still trusted by Cao Cao. In The History of the Three Kingdoms and Biography of Cao Zhi, it is said that "the twenty-fifth year of cultivation is marked by the talent of a famous childe, and it is served by Mao", and it is also said that "it is timely, the military affairs are numerous, and the cultivation always knows the inside and the outside, and everything means what it means. Since Prince Wei has gone down, he has strived for friendship. " Looking at these two paragraphs, we can see two problems. First, Yang Xiu's talent is outstanding, so he will be appointed as the chief editor of Cao Cao's "knowing everything inside and outside", and "everything is agreeable". In this way, Cao Cao should pay more attention to him and trust him at this time, otherwise, he will not be given this position. Second, it can be seen from the sentence "Since Prince Wei has left, he has strived for friendship" that even Prince Wei Cao Pi wanted to curry favor with him at that time, and the word "and" struggle "also showed that many people were trying to curry favor with him, not the prince alone, so it is conceivable that his position was important at that time. On the other hand, this can prove that Yang Xiu should be trusted and relied on by Cao Cao at this time, and the relationship is relatively close. Otherwise, there is no reason to appear the situation of "since Prince Wei has gone down, and strive for friendship".
At that time, Cao Cao was hesitant about who would be the prince of Cao Pi and Cao Zhi to inherit Wang Wei.

Xu said, "I miss Yuan Benchu and Liu Jingsheng." Mao laughed, so the prince decided. " From this, we can know that Cao Cao, despite his poetic temperament, was a politician first. Jia Xu showed him the advantages and disadvantages and lessons learned from that era on the issue of heirs. For him, maintaining the stability and long-term political power after his death is the first thing, and everything else can make way, including his own personal likes and dislikes.
